When the light shines in a dark room, initially it blinds you and the world disappears. When you get used to the light, the forms, the world reappears with clarity.
The initial loss of phenomenal meaning is natural result of the revelation of the reality of consciousness. What follows is phenomena regaining a sweet, happy and joyful meaning. Full of awe and wonder.
Questioner:
mmmmm
Reply:
First, in ignorance, I, consciousness, am a phenomenal event, a mortal body mind.
Next, in the glimpse, I am consciousness and all phenomenal events are not real and disappear.
Finally, I am consciousness as everyone and everything. The world, body and mind appear as myself, non dual.
Neti neti is the interim stage.
First I am the mortal body mind and the world is external to me.
Next, I am consciousness and I am not the body, mind or world.
Finally, I am infinite universal consciousness manifesting as the world, body and mind…. as one.

Reply:
Once the sense of separation has been removed from the mind via understanding and from the body via releasing, the dream becomes sweet.
The initial separate phenomenal world is first perceived external to me. Then it is seen to be unreal and non existent and finally it appears as a celebratory creative and happy play.
Compassion is a quality of consciousness and not of the form. Com-Passion is passion for everything. Passion for wholeness.
It is not a quality of the mind. It is a quality of consciousness…. that is void of a compassionate person image.
No person.
Not personal.
Not an activity.
Like the perfume of a rose is not an activity of the rose. It is a quality of the rose.
